当前位置: 首页 > news >正文

常用的字符串方法 String ;

 

字符串:

1,str.charAt(num);//根据下标查找字符串中对应的字符,返回对应下标的字符;

2,str.charCodeAt(num);//字符串中下标对应的那位字符的 Unicode编码,返回一个字符对应的编码;

3,str.fromCharCode(num);//根据对应的编码返回对应的字符;

4,str.indexOf();//根据字符查找字符串中是否存在字符,找到返回对应的下标,没找到返回-1;

5,str.lastIndexOf();//从后往前查找,查找到返回正序下标,没找到同样返回-1;

6,str.substring(num,num);//一个参数表示从哪开始截取 ,直到最后.两个参数时,表示从哪开始截取,到哪结束,但不包括结束位,大小则调换位置,查找到返回对应的字符,没查找到返回空的字符串"";

7,str.substr(num,num);//一个参数时,当前(参数)截取到随后,两个参数,第二个表示截取几位,返回截取到的字符;

8,str.slice(num,num);//一个参数下标为正数的时候,表示从哪开始截取,返回从下表位开始直到最后的字符串,超出范围返回空的字符'',为负数则倒着查找,返回查找到的字符,

9,str.toUpperCase();//不传参数,将小写字母转化为全大写,返回转换后的结果;

 10,str.toLowerCase();//不传参数,将大写字符串中字母转换成全小写;

11,str.split();//分割字符串,返回一个分割后的数组,参数用来分割;

 12,str.replice("a","A"); //替换字符串字符,返回一个新的字符串;

 

 

 W3school 更多的字符串操作方法 : http://www.w3school.com.cn/jsref/jsref_obj_string.asp

转载于:https://www.cnblogs.com/week-1/p/6537096.html

相关文章:

  • 在SQL Server 2008上实现资源的负载均衡
  • 【转】angular基本概念的认识与实战
  • SQL Server中未公布的扩展存储过程
  • 利用jQuery中live为动态生成Dom添加datepicker效果
  • ABAP clear,refresh,free清空内表的区别
  • 作为软件开发人员应该知道的最基本的东西
  • 让IE6、IE7、IE8、IE9、IE10、IE11支持Bootstrap的解决方法
  • 虚拟服务器负载均衡实现方法
  • 架构重构改善既有代码的设计
  • 详解SQL Server中创建数据仓库已分区表
  • SQL server故障转移和负载均衡
  • [LeetCode]284. Peeking Iterator(C++,类,暴力)
  • SQL Server——海量数据库的查询优化及分页算法方案
  • 什么样的代码才是好代码
  • prototype 常用方法
  • 《剑指offer》分解让复杂问题更简单
  • 30天自制操作系统-2
  • CSS实用技巧干货
  • Docker 1.12实践:Docker Service、Stack与分布式应用捆绑包
  • ES6 学习笔记(一)let,const和解构赋值
  • JavaScript 是如何工作的:WebRTC 和对等网络的机制!
  • PHP 7 修改了什么呢 -- 2
  • Vim 折腾记
  • 普通函数和构造函数的区别
  • 深度学习入门:10门免费线上课程推荐
  • 一个SAP顾问在美国的这些年
  • 用element的upload组件实现多图片上传和压缩
  • 鱼骨图 - 如何绘制?
  • 自制字幕遮挡器
  • 阿里云ACE认证学习知识点梳理
  • 阿里云IoT边缘计算助力企业零改造实现远程运维 ...
  • 分布式关系型数据库服务 DRDS 支持显示的 Prepare 及逻辑库锁功能等多项能力 ...
  • 进程与线程(三)——进程/线程间通信
  • ​ 轻量应用服务器:亚马逊云科技打造全球领先的云计算解决方案
  • ​低代码平台的核心价值与优势
  • #微信小程序:微信小程序常见的配置传值
  • #我与Java虚拟机的故事#连载03:面试过的百度,滴滴,快手都问了这些问题
  • %3cscript放入php,跟bWAPP学WEB安全(PHP代码)--XSS跨站脚本攻击
  • (2020)Java后端开发----(面试题和笔试题)
  • (备忘)Java Map 遍历
  • (二十四)Flask之flask-session组件
  • (教学思路 C#之类三)方法参数类型(ref、out、parmas)
  • (转)memcache、redis缓存
  • (转载)hibernate缓存
  • .360、.halo勒索病毒的最新威胁:如何恢复您的数据?
  • .desktop 桌面快捷_Linux桌面环境那么多,这几款优秀的任你选
  • .NET CF命令行调试器MDbg入门(三) 进程控制
  • .net 程序 换成 java,NET程序员如何转行为J2EE之java基础上(9)
  • .net知识和学习方法系列(二十一)CLR-枚举
  • .NET中两种OCR方式对比
  • .so文件(linux系统)
  • @Autowired和@Resource装配
  • []使用 Tortoise SVN 创建 Externals 外部引用目录
  • [2013][note]通过石墨烯调谐用于开关、传感的动态可重构Fano超——
  • [C# WPF] 如何给控件添加边框(Border)?